I bought the 'Love Actually' Original Soundtrack for my wife. We went to the cinema to watch the film while she was pregnant with our firstborn, and it seemed fitting to obtain the soundtrack. The film, in brief, is a tale of many romances interwoven and interlinked by the characters in it. It has a whole horde of star British actors and actresses, and is accompanied by a wonderful soundtrack.
There are 20 tracks, many by famous names but some by unknowns. I found this to be a wonderful balance of romance, intermingled with some fun poppy numbers and even some classical music. A very well balanced CD.
The tracks:
There are 20 tracks. Here they are:
1. Girls Aloud - Jump (For My Love)
2. Sugababes - Too Lost In You
3. Kelly Clarkson - The Trouble With Love Is
4. Dido - Here With Me
5. Billy Mack - Christmas Is All Around
6. Norah Jones - Turn Me On
7. Eva Cassidy - Songbird
8. Maroon 5 - Sweetest Goodbye
9. The Calling - Wherever You Will Go
10. Texas - I'll See It Through
11. Joni Mitchell - Both Sides Now
12. Otis Reading - White Christmas
13. Wyclef Jean featuring Sharissa - Take Me As I Am
14. Olivia Olsen - All I Want For Chrstmas Is You
15. The Beach Boys - God Only Knows
16. Lynden David Hall - All You Need Is Love
17. Gabrielle - Sometimes
18. Craig Armstrong - Glasgow Love Theme
19. Craig Armstrong - PM's Love Theme
20. Portugese Love Theme
As you can see, there is a wonderful mix of tracks here, many of which were released as singles. There is even one there, number 5, by Billy Mack, who is actually the character in the film played by Bill Nighy! I loved this album as well as the film.
